Kymani
Meaning
modern coinage, notably borne by Ky-Mani Marley; said to mean 'adventurous traveler'
Popularity, 1890–2024
Shape drawn from US Social Security baby-name records. Kymani peaked in the 2010s.
When you meet Kymani
Most people given the name Kymani in the United States are children or teenagers today. The name belongs to this generation.
Estimated from US Social Security birth registrations and typical lifespans; a rough guide, not a rule.
